Autor Zpráva
martin27
Profil
Jak mám udělat toto menu aby fungovali obe ane jen jedno?

:
<html>
<head>

<title>Dropdown Sample</title>

<script type="text/javascript" src="dropdown.js">
</script>

</head>
<body>

<table border="1" bordercolor="green" width="50%" height="4%">
<tr>
<td>
<!-- Dropdown Menu -->

<div id="menu_paren"
style="width: 100px; border: 1px solid black; background: #FFFFEE; padding: 0px 6px;
font-weight: 900; color: #008000;" float:left;">
Main Menu
</div>
<div id="menu_child"
style="position: absolute; visibility: hidden; background: #FFFFEE;">
<a style="display: block; width: 100px; border: 1px solid black; padding: 0px 5px; text-decoration: none; font-weight: 900; color: #0000C0; border-bottom: none;" href="#">Item 1</a>
<a style="display: block; width: 100px; border: 1px solid black; padding: 0px 5px; text-decoration: none; font-weight: 900; color: #0000C0; border-bottom: none;" href="#">Item 2</a>
<a style="display: block; width: 100px; border: 1px solid black; padding: 0px 5px; text-decoration: none; font-weight: 900; color: #0000C0;" href="#">Item 3</a>
</div>

<script type="text/javascript">
at_attach("menu_parent", "menu_child", "hover", "y", "pointer");
</script>
</td>
<td>
<!-- Dropdown Menu -->

<div id="menu_parent"
style="width: 100px; border: 1px solid black; background: #FFFFEE; padding: 0px 5px;
font-weight: 900; color: #008000;" float:right;">
Main Menu
</div>
<div id="menu_child"
style="position: absolute; visibility: hidden; background: #FFFFEE;">
<a style="display: block; width: 100px; border: 1px solid black; padding: 0px 5px; text-decoration: none; font-weight: 900; color: #0000C0; border-bottom: none;" href="#">Item 1</a>
<a style="display: block; width: 100px; border: 1px solid black; padding: 0px 5px; text-decoration: none; font-weight: 900; color: #0000C0; border-bottom: none;" href="#">Item 2</a>
<a style="display: block; width: 100px; border: 1px solid black; padding: 0px 5px; text-decoration: none; font-weight: 900; color: #0000C0;" href="#">Item 3</a>
</div>

<script type="text/javascript">
at_attach("menu_parent", "menu_child", "hover", "#00000", "pointer");
</script>
</td>
</table>
</body>
</html>
INSiGHT
Profil
U toho prvního chybí v id písmeno t!
Pokud tedy nejde o chybu při přepisu.
Tim
Profil *
Ja by som chcel vedet jak sa na stránku dá také menu s tlačítkami, že to nebudú len slovné odkazy ale normálne tlačítka.
INSiGHT
Profil
Tim:
Co takhle si založit vlastní téma?

Jinak koukni třeba sem http://css.interval.cz/menu/
martin27
Profil
no jo ale to t to kdyz tam je tak to taky nefunguje
INSiGHT
Profil
No protože nemůžeš mít dvě id na jeden script.
Musíš oběma menu dát různá id a tím pádem vložit taky dva scripty, v němž přepíšeš akorát to nový id.
Nejsem na JavaScript odborník, ale zkus to;-)
martin27
Profil
Dík už to funguje můžu ještě ňák udělat že když se otevře to rozbalovací menu tak jedu na ňákou položku a pozadí v tý položce změní barvu jak to mám udělat a kam to mám napsat dík moc
INSiGHT
Profil
Do CSS musíš zapsat a:hover {background-color: #000;}.
To dá všem odkazům po najetí myší černou barvu pozadí.
martin27
Profil
dík moc hodně si mi pomohl
martin27
Profil
jak to mám udělat na jeden cíl jako aby mi každý odkaz pak po najetí neměl v pozadí černou barvu ale jen jeden. dík
Tim
Profil *
INSiGHT:

diki za ten odkaz, o tej stránke som nevedel a tam su dobre veci
Toto téma je uzamčeno. Odpověď nelze zaslat.